Output 159804f0d31586d4db8a6d3311ba30d28eda86ebc083a18dfd580164f7df00e8:0

value
8833700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b166b0ee3c603514e05fd38e55713f074254388d OP_EQUAL
address
3Hs2YbvQGwS4f5tnPYfSjnHZebTjJ7zAf6
transaction
159804f0d31586d4db8a6d3311ba30d28eda86ebc083a18dfd580164f7df00e8
spent
true